2015-12-16 3 views
1

Collegues, я пытаюсь запустить приложение Mule в IntelliJ IDEA. Я настроил Run Configuration:java.lang.ClassNotFoundException при запуске Mule apllication от IntelliJ IDEA

Main class: org.mule.MuleServer 
    VM options: -Dmule.verbose.exceptions=true 
    Program arguments: -config \src\main\app\mule-config.xml 
    Working directory: C:\Users\Maya\app-services 
    JRE: Default (1.8 - SDK of 'app-services' module) 

Когда я запускаю затем получить следующую трассировку стеки: http://pastebin.com/24Mf3bsy

Что мне нужно, чтобы проверить и исправить?

ответ

1

Это, кажется, проблема с classpath. Есть org.mule.MuleServer в вашем classpath?

+0

Я посмотрел в системных переменных, в переменную Path и нет ничего о Mule. Также он работал в Eclipse. – May12

+0

Я не использовал IntelliJ. Я имел в виду путь сборки Eclipse. Я предполагаю, что аналогичная функциональность может присутствовать в IntelliJ для обозначения внешних банок. – harshavmb

0

I мой случай:

  1. Set Up Настройка выполнения, как мы проделали в вопросе выше
  2. Presse F4 на проект
  3. Изменить все библиотеки Maven из provided в compile.
  4. Нажмите ОК. Запустить приложение.

    project structure

Смежные вопросы